How To Evaluate Organic Beauty Products Effectively

When it comes to altering your beauty routine with organic products, knowing how to evaluate them efficiently is crucial. The organic beauty market is abundant, but not all products live up to their claims. It’s essential to sift through the noise and identify quality options that truly benefit your skin and health.

A key aspect of effective evaluation involves understanding the ingredient list. Organic products often boast natural components, but some may still contain harmful additives. You should familiarize yourself with common toxins and controversial substances that could compromise your health, even in a product labeled “organic.” This awareness will empower you to make informed choices.

    Steps To Assess Quality

  1. Check for certification labels (USDA Organic, COSMOS, etc.).
  2. Research the brand’s reputation and transparency about sourcing.
  3. Review the ingredient list for any harmful additives.
  4. Look for third-party testing for efficacy and purity.
  5. Seek customer reviews to gauge real-life results.
  6. Consider the product’s packaging and its environmental impact.

Essential Oils

Essential oils are a powerhouse in the world of organic beauty. They are highly concentrated extracts from plants, offering a myriad of benefits depending on their source. For instance, tea tree oil is celebrated for its antibacterial properties, making it invaluable for acne-prone skin. On the other hand, lavender oil serves a calming effect, helping to alleviate stress and enhance relaxation, which is beneficial for overall skin health.

Natural Moisturizers

Another category of key ingredients in organic products is natural moisturizers. Ingredients like shea butter and jojoba oil provide deep hydration without the use of synthetic additives that can lead to irritation. These natural moisturizers work synergistically with the skin to promote hydration and maintain a healthy barrier, ensuring that your beauty routine is both effective and safe for the skin.

Sustainable Farming Practices

Organic farmers often engage in practices such as crop rotation, cover cropping, and composting, which help maintain nutrient-dense soils and foster a thriving ecosystem. Moreover, these methods result in minimal soil erosion and water runoff, leading to cleaner waterways and improved local habitats. By choosing organic beauty products, you are directly supporting an agricultural system that favors soil health and biodiversity.

Steps For Selection:

  1. Identify your skin type: oily, dry, combination, or sensitive.
  2. Research organic ingredients suitable for your specific skin needs.
  3. Check for certifications: look for trusted organic labels.
  4. Read product reviews and testimonials for real-life effectiveness.
  5. Patch test new products before full application.
  6. Consult with a dermatologist if you’re unsure about which products to use.
  7. Keep track of how your skin reacts to new products over time.

Identifying your skin type is the first critical step towards making informed decisions. Oily skin may require lightweight formulations that combat excess sebum, while dry skin necessitates richer, hydrating products. Combination skin can benefit from a balanced approach, using different products in different areas. Sensitive skin often requires gentle, hypoallergenic ingredients to avoid irritation.

Identifying Skin Type

Understanding how to identify your skin type is vital. Look for signs such as shine, dryness, or redness after washing your face. This knowledge enables you to filter through organic products and select those that align perfectly with your skin’s needs, reducing the likelihood of adverse reactions.

Challenges You May Encounter With Organic Products

While organic products have gained popularity for their numerous benefits, using them can come with certain challenges. Understanding these challenges is crucial for anyone considering a switch in their beauty regimen. One major hurdle is the availability of authentic organic products, which may not be as readily available in local stores compared to conventional beauty items. Additionally, consumers often find it overwhelming to navigate the vast array of options and certifications, making the selection process complicated.

Another challenge you might face is the price point. Organic products typically come with a higher price tag than their synthetic counterparts due to the quality of ingredients and sustainable sourcing practices. This can deter potential users who are looking for budget-friendly choices. Furthermore, users might also experience inconsistencies in product performance. Organic formulations can behave differently on various skin types, so it may take some experimentation to find the right match.

    Common Drawbacks

  • Higher price point than conventional products
  • Limited availability in some regions
  • Potential for inconsistencies in product effectiveness
  • The need for careful label scrutiny and ingredient understanding
  • Shorter shelf life due to lack of preservatives
  • Allergic reactions to certain natural ingredients
